What is the difference between a metal and a non-metal?
Metals generally have properties like being shiny (lustrous), hard, malleable (can be hammered into sheets), ductile (can be drawn into wires), and good conductors of heat and electricity. Non-metals, on the other hand, are usually dull, brittle (break easily), and poor conductors of heat and electricity. They can exist as solids, liquids, or gases at room temperature.
